**Casual Residential Childcare Worker**

**Team: The Bungalow Children's Home (FARCYJ)**

**Location: Preston**

**Basic Salary**:£12.47 per hour **(additional 25% of hourly rate for weekend working, and 50% for bank holidays). Sleeping in allowance of £37.72 for overnight stays with additional payment should your sleep be disturbed)
**We are currently recruiting **

**Casual residential childcare workers **to work at **The Bungalow which is short stay children's home **(FARCYJ) **within **Children's Social Services **at Lancashire County Council.

As a Residential Childcare worker, your position within Children's Social Services will play a vital role supporting young people **who live within our children's home **. We are a **1 bed **children's home **based in Fulwood, Preston, who look after young people aged between 13-18, often with social, emotional and/or behavioural difficulties. An integral part of your role will be working with our young person on a day-to-day basis, helping them to develop lifelong skills and sharing experiences which will support them with moving into their forever home and then stay with them into adulthood. Furthermore, you will provide them with support, advice and guidance in all aspects of their lives and help them to become the best they can be. You will work within an experienced team who have the same ethos as you and who can help you to develop within your role. You will also have opportunities to work with other teams and agencies, such as health and education, to create a bespoke package of care for our young person.

As a casual member of staff you will work on an 'as and when' basis including weekends and sleeping in, ensuring the home is covered 24/7, 365 days a year.

**Driving**:Although this post does not require you to have your own vehicle, it does require all applicants to have a full UK driving licence. Transporting our young person to and from family visits as well as in emergency situations is an integral part of the role, therefore the ability to drive our fleet vehicles is essential.

**Benefits**:As a casual worker you can opt in to shifts you are offered in our home and a number of other homes across Lancashire should you have the availability. As a casual worker you are not entitled to annual leave however an additional payment of 7% of your pay is added to your wages to compensate you for this. Increased hourly rate for weekend working as well as a nightly rate for sleeping over at the children's home. As we are a home, we like to encourage our staff to have their meals with the children so meals for staff are provided when on shift. LCC has a generous local government pension with shared AVC's available & a benefits package which has everything from holidays with the young person, long service awards, Medicash, support groups, cycle to work schemes and eye tests, plus much more.
